Alloy is looking for an Applied AI Engineer to sit within our centralized Ops team and drive meaningful AI transformation across the entire business. This is a high-impact, cross-functional role for someone who loves finding inefficiencies, designing elegant solutions, and enabling people to work smarter.

You'll be the connective tissue between cutting-edge AI capabilities and the practical, day-to-day needs of our teams - identifying where automation and AI can reduce toil, accelerate workflows, and unlock capacity for higher-value work.

- Identify high-impact automation and AI opportunities across the business, prioritized against strategic goals

- Design, build, and deploy AI-powered solutions - from lightweight automations to more sophisticated LLM-based workflows

- Partner with teams across Alloy to understand their pain points and translate them into scalable technical solutions

- Champion and enable AI adoption across the organization - running enablement sessions, building internal tooling, and helping teams become more self-sufficient

- Establish best practices, tooling standards, and frameworks for how Alloy builds and evaluates AI solutions

- Operate the internal stack like a product, running experiments, creating feedback loops, and continuously improving productivity across the whole organization.

- Measure the impact of what you ship and continuously iterate

- Hands-on experience building with LLMs and AI APIs (e.g. OpenAI, Anthropic, etc.) in production environments

- Strong engineering fundamentals - comfortable writing clean, maintainable code in Python or similar

- Experience with workflow automation tools (e.g. Zapier, Make, n8n, or custom-built pipelines)

- A business-minded approach: you think about ROI and impact, not just technical elegance

- Excellent communication skills - you can explain complex AI concepts to non-technical stakeholders and bring people along on the journey

- Experience in an ops, revenue operations, or business systems role

You'll have a rare combination of autonomy and breadth - working across every team at Alloy, with a direct line to business impact. This isn't a role where you'll be handed a backlog. You'll define the roadmap, build the solutions, and see the results.
